The XC4052XLA-09HQ160I is a Field-Programmable Gate Array (FPGA) from Xilinx Inc., belonging to the XC4000XL family. This FPGA provides a configurable hardware platform for implementing custom digital logic circuits. FPGAs are used in diverse applications due to their flexibility and ability to be reprogrammed even after being deployed in a system.
Applications:
- Telecommunications equipment
- Networking devices
- Industrial control systems
- Medical imaging devices
- Aerospace and defense applications
- High-performance computing
Features:
- Configurable Logic Blocks (CLBs)
- Programmable interconnect matrix
- Input/Output Blocks (IOBs)
- On-chip RAM (Block RAM)
- On-chip clock management
- 160-pin HQFP (Quad Flat Pack) package
- -09 Speed Grade
- Industrial Temperature Range (I)
Benefits:
- Flexibility to implement custom logic circuits
- Ability to reconfigure the device after deployment
- Hardware acceleration for performance-critical tasks
- Integration of multiple functions into a single device
- Reduced development time and cost compared to ASICs
The XC4052XLA-09HQ160I offers a significant amount of configurable logic and memory resources. The CLBs are the basic building blocks for implementing digital logic. The programmable interconnect matrix allows for flexible routing of signals between CLBs and IOBs. The on-chip RAM provides storage for data and intermediate results. The on-chip clock management provides clock signals for the internal logic. The HQ160 package is a 160-pin Quad Flat Pack package, providing a compact and surface-mountable form factor. The "-09" designates the speed grade, indicating the performance level of the device, and "I" specifies the industrial temperature range, typically -40°C to +85°C. FPGAs are typically programmed using Hardware Description Languages (HDLs) such as VHDL or Verilog.